Course Description

Making earth gravitation working model, in this course introduces students to the fundamental concept of gravity in a creative and practical way. In this course, learners will build a hands-on model that demonstrates how Earth’s gravitational force attracts objects towards its center. Using simple materials such as balls, magnets, cardboard, or a stretchable fabric surface, students will explore how objects fall, why planets orbit, and how mass influences gravitational pull. Step by step, the course explains Newton’s law of gravitation and its role in daily life and space science. Learners will also perform small experiments showing how gravity acts equally on all objects, regardless of size, and how it governs the motion of celestial bodies. This project makes abstract physics concepts easy to visualize, while encouraging curiosity and innovation. Perfect for school science projects, exhibitions, and classroom demonstrations, the course combines theory with creativity. By the end, participants will have a functional gravitation model that clearly illustrates one of the most important forces in nature and deepens their understanding of the universe. howtofunda
